Managing Research Data
In the ever-evolving landscape of information management, "Managing Research Data" by Graham Pryor is an indispensable resource for information professionals. Published by Facet Publishing in 2012, this insightful paperback spans 224 pages and delves into the critical aspects of effective data management. Pryor expertly outlines the necessary skills, legal and contractual obligations, and strategies required to foster a robust culture of data management. This book is ideal for those looking to enhance their understanding of data processing and database management within archives and special libraries. With a focus on practical advice and the development of comprehensive management plans, "Managing Research Data" equips readers with the knowledge to navigate the complexities of data management infrastructure.
